### Account Recovery — Catalogue Import (Lintwood)

Quick one for review: when the Lintwood catalogue import wipes a patron's session table, the recovery flow re-seeds accounts from the nightly snapshot. Check that the importer skips locked accounts — last time it didn't. To rerun recovery against staging you'll need the vault passphrase, which is appended just below.

recovery phrase for yafof-tajof: julmir-kelax-julvan-holath-belvan-holir-ralael-ralvan-ralath-julvan-silmir-istmir-kaswyn-ulamir

## Artifact Signing — HarrowLink Gateway

All firmware bundles for the HarrowLink telemetry gateway must be signed before they ship to dealer support portals. Unsigned builds are rejected by the device bootloader, so support should never sideload raw images. Builds from the Tillson pipeline are signed automatically; manual hotfixes require the current key. The active signing key is:

deploy key for yajop-fahop: bky3_h1v

## Formula sandbox tuning

User-supplied formulas in Gridmoor execute inside a restricted interpreter with hard ceilings on time, memory, and call depth. Reviewers should confirm any change to these ceilings is justified in the PR description, since raising them widens the abuse surface. Defaults were chosen from production traces. The current limits are as follows.

limits module of tafog-fawip:
WEIGHTS = {
    "julix": 57,
    "lamys": 992,
    "kasvan": 209,
    "quenok": 750,
    "alddor": 259,
    "oliath": 1009,
    "wenix": 815,
}

The garage occupancy feed for the Brindlewood campus arrives over a message queue every thirty seconds, one record per level, published by the Stallgrid edge boxes. Counts can briefly go negative when a sensor double-fires on exit; the ingest job clamps these to zero and flags the interval. If the feed stalls for more than five minutes, the dashboard falls back to the last known snapshot. Sensor mappings, queue names, and the replay procedure are documented on the internal page below.

runbook for tahog-kadug: https://gitlab.qirvanworks.corp/projects/pages/view/b139298aed28